The New Yorker receives around 1,000 cartoons each week; it only publishes about 17 of them. A closer look at The New Yorker cartoons.The first New Yorker cartoon created by a woman, Ethel Plummer, appeared in the première issue, on February 21, 1925. According to his obit in the NYTs (Aug 18, 1967) Hilton was a cartoonist since age 14 when the San Francisco Chronicle began running his work. Besides The New Yorker, Hilton’s work appeared in Esquire, Life, and Look magazines. NYer work: May 19, 1934 — June 15, 1957. Trevor Hoey NYer work: October 12, 2009 –.

Buy New Yorker Cartoons ». Barry Blitt, a cartoonist and an illustrator, has contributed to The New Yorker since 1992. In 2020, he won the Pulitzer Prize for editorial cartooning.
